Method 1: Making a Single Photo Private on Facebook

1. Open Facebook. Go to https://www.facebook.com/ in your web browser. This will open your News Feed if you're logged right into Facebook.

- If you typically aren't logged right into Facebook, enter your e-mail address and also password to do so.

2. Go to your account. Click your name in the top-right side of the Facebook page.

3. Click the Photos tab. You'll discover this listed below the cover picture that's at the top of your Facebook web page.

4. Select a photo category. Click a category tab (e.g., Your Pictures) near the top of the page.

5. Select a picture. Click a picture that you intend to make private. This will open the photo.

- The photo has to be one that you uploaded, not just one of you that somebody else published.

6. Click the "Privacy" icon. This icon generally appears like a silhouette of an individual (or 2 people) that you'll locate listed below and also to the right of your name in the upper-right side of the image. A drop-down menu will show up.

- If clicking this symbol leads to a menu that states Edit Post Privacy, click Edit Post Privacy to visit the post, after that click the privacy symbol on top of the post before proceeding.

7. Click More ... It remains in the drop-down menu.

8. Click Only Me. This choice is in the increased drop-down menu. Doing so will right away change your picture's personal privacy to make sure that just you can see it.

Technique 2: Making an Album Private on Facebook

1. Click your name in the Facebook display's upper ideal edge to open your profile.

2. Click the "Photos" link to open up the Photos and Videos page.

3. Click an album to open it.

4. Float your computer mouse arrow over the symbol to the right of the album's name. Text appears stating the album's existing privacy setup. As an example, the album may have a globe icon as well as the setting "Public".

5. Click the symbol to open a drop-down menu.

6. Click "Only Me" to conceal the album.
